Job Description

JS Held’s Accident Reconstruction practice is seeking an experienced Accident Reconstruction Engineer. The ideal candidate for this position has a strong interest in accident reconstruction, as well as a foundation of experience in expert witness testimony. In addition to their core engineering work, candidates will be responsible for developing business opportunities with current and prospective clients, mentoring and training junior engineers, and occasionally participating in informative presentations for clients and peers.

Candidates should feel comfortable working in a fast-paced and collaborative consulting environment which requires a high degree of self-motivation, professionalism, organization, responsiveness, and resilience to stress. Previous experience managing projects and developing business opportunities is required.

  • Manage accident reconstruction projects and clients.
  • Identify, develop, and secure new business opportunities.
  • Conduct unbiased field investigations and testing of incidents and/or loss events.
  • Provide technical findings, analysis, and conclusions, either verbally or in writing, in a timely fashion and in laymen’s terms.
  • Travel for inspections, field work, marketing, and business development.
  • Maintain communication with client and project team on status and scope of assigned projects.
  • Maintain technical and professional knowledge related to the engineer’s practice area(s) through attending continuing education courses and workshops, attending industry/practice related seminars, reviewing relevant scientific and professional publications, and participating in professional organizations and societies.
  • Continuously meet or exceed assigned performance metrics and goals.
